Brigham Young University’s Fulton College of Engineering and Technology is consistently ranked among the top engineering schools in the nation. The college offers a variety of degrees, including Bachelor of Science degrees in Electrical Engineering, Computer Science, Mechanical Engineering, and Civil Engineering. Admission requirements for each degree vary depending on the type and level of degree being pursued. For undergraduate programs, applicants must have a minimum 3.0 GPA on all college-level coursework taken prior to application. They must also demonstrate an aptitude for mathematics and science by achieving a satisfactory score on either the ACT or SAT exams. Additionally, students must submit two letters of recommendation from faculty members who can attest to their academic abilities. Finally, applicants must provide an essay detailing their goals for pursuing an engineering education at BYU and how it will benefit them in their future professional endeavors.

Brigham Young University’s Fulton College of Engineering and Technology has an impressive placement rate. The college boasts a 95% placement rate within six months of graduation, with the majority of graduates finding employment in the technology, engineering, and computer science fields. Graduates from all departments have gone on to work for some of the biggest names in tech, such as Apple, Microsoft, Amazon, and Google. In addition to these prestigious companies, many alumni have also found success at smaller startups and local businesses. With an average starting salary of $62,000 per year for graduates with a bachelor’s degree in engineering or technology-related fields, it is easy to see why so many students are eager to pursue their degrees at Brigham Young University’s Fulton College of Engineering and Technology.

Fall 2006 Admissions Statistics
Total applicants (master’s and Ph.D.): 291
Total acceptances (master’s and Ph.D.): 176
Overall acceptance rate: 60.5%

Fall 2006 Enrollment
Total first-year enrollment (master’s and Ph.D.): 122
GRE required? Yes

2006 entering class:

Average GPA (number reporting) Average verbal GRE score (number reporting) Average quantitative GRE score (number reporting) Average analytical GRE score (number reporting) Average writing GRE score (number reporting)
New entrants in master’s program 3.6 (130) 591 (119) 692 (119) 720 (1) 4.63 (118)
New entrants in doctoral program 3.6 (34) 585 (33) 731 (33) 745 (2) 4.4 (31)
New entrants in both master’s and doctoral programs 3.6 (164) 590 (152) 701 (152) 737 (3) 4.58 (149)

TOEFL
TOEFL required for international students? Yes
Minimum TOEFL score required for paper test: 580
Minimum TOEFL score required for computer test: 237
